So I have apparently been blessed with a bad role of filament. I've been thinking there was a problem with my printer since I couldn't get a decent print out of this spool of white ABS. The finish on everything was horrible, almost like a completely new uncalibrated RepRap. Not being able to resolve the issue after attempting to fix every other possibility, I switched out the filament to another white ABS. Problem Solved!

Both printed on the same printer, same day, same settings. Nothing changed but the ABS itself.

The Bad spool seems consistent in diameter, not sure what the issue is. Any thoughts?

(I know its a little tough to see any defects on the "good" yoda, but trust me, it looks 100 times better than the "bad" one.)
If the diameter is consistent then it may be moisture in the plastic. Or just poor plastic quality, perhaps it was made with regrind or recycled plastic.

You could try drying the plastic with gentle heat and see if the print quality improves. Some people use their oven, but you need to make sure it can hold a stable temp at the low end of its range.

If the plastic quality is bad there's no way to tell for sure without doing a melt index / flow analysis. Which is probably outside the capabilities of most hobbiests.

i found with my black filament there was a chain of air bubbles in the filament running along the centre what was happening was the gas expands and makes your flow rate inconsistant

And it turns out the problem is air bubbles inside the filament. I cut it open to find tiny little bubbles through out it.
